Writing Australian History with Pamela Hart

Stuff you need to know...

Picture
Pamela Hart (nee Freeman) is offering a special workshop on writing Australian history when she comes up for the Sorcery to Spaceships weekend! The Soldier’s Wife is the first book published under that name, inspired by her grandfather’s service as an ANZAC at Gallipoli. As Pamela Freeman, she's written children’s fiction, epic fantasy, crime fiction and children’s poetry.
The two-hour workshop will focus on the sources, approaches, and pitfalls of writing historical fiction.
